1. Emergency Essentials
Emergency essentials is my go-to for the best combo packages of freeze dried or dehydrated meats and cheeses. They are the most affordable and items can be purchases a-la-carte, or in a set. I like the sets because they are the most affordable and get rave reviews for taste and quality. The meat combo is 6 #10 (that’s about a gallon) cans of hamburger, sausage, turkey, chicken, ham and something else that escapes me at this moment…costs about $230 dollars and will be worth every penny to me in a time of need.
